Real gains in educational technology will come from mediating in-person social interactions (focused on knowledge building rather than general purpose interactions, of course).

In many instances, the teacher actually knows what should be done to improve the learning of a student - but is logistically constrained from providing that level of service (Bloom's 2 sigma problem). The low hanging fruit is removing those constraints.

We will need better tools for understanding the knowledge/abilities of our students in a much more refined manner.
